It's really more for mafia. Because our polls don't keep track of vote order, it puts the word aubergine in there in order to make an easily searchable term that shouldn't come up in mafia. Makes it easier to identify vote order.

It is a legit strategy that you gain more information from team votes (who approves, who disapproves) than you do from running a mission. But at some point we will have to actually pass one to start solving who's good and who's bad.
Part of the reason I've disapproved twice is that I don't know who to trust yet, and if I'm not on the mission I especially don't trust it.
